As doll lovers, we are fortunate to be able to participate in our hobby by buying new dolls, accessories, and more. It’s important for us as a community to share our good fortune with others. Each year since the first Pullip and Dal Doll Lovers Event, we’ve made a donation to one or more worthy causes. We like to tie the organization to the theme in some way, and we like to choose an organization with a local tie. A portion of the money raised through raffle and silent auction sales is donated to the organization on behalf of the Pullip and Dal Doll Lovers Event.

Our 2016 theme is Space, and this year we will be donating to the Chicago Bird Collision Monitors. The CBCM helps migrating songbirds, who have navigated by the light of the stars for millions of years but are now confused by manmade lights.
